“Go to Detroit,” Anchor, December 1, 2017

Students and Teachers in the Lord’s Lenten School, 3rd Wednesday of Lent, March 22, 2017

The New Heart God Gives and Maintains through the Priesthood, 18th Thursday (II), August 4, 2016

The Wisest Investment of Our Life, Memorial of St. Margaret, June 10, 2016

The Bread of Angels Made the Food of Pilgrims, Corpus Christi, May 29, 2016

The Mercy That Prepares Us for the Mercy of the Eucharist, The Anchor, May 27, 2016

Becoming Ambassadors of Mercy Incarnate and Ministers of Mercy Above All, Tulsa Clergy Convocation, January 25-27, 2016

The Feast of God’s Infinite Mercy, Mass of Christmas at Dawn, December 25, 2015

Receiving or Resisting God’s Inseparable Love, 30th Thursday (I), October 29, 2015

Pondering our Consecration through the Lens of SS. Simon and Jude, October 28, 2015

Seeing in Action Christ the High Priest, 30th Sunday (B), October 25, 2015

Trusting that Nothing is Impossible for God, 20th Tuesday (I), August 18, 2015

Mary Assumed into Heaven, The Help of Christians, Solemnity of the Assumption, August 15, 2015

Spending, Like St. John Vianney, The Billions of God’s Mercy We’ve Received, 19th Thursday (I), August 13, 2015

The Curé of Ars and Living a Truly Eucharistic Life, August 4, 2015

The Occasionally Frightening Way the Lord Helps Us Grow in Faith, 18th Tuesday (I), August 4, 2015

The Faith That Solicits Miracles, Thirteenth Thursday (I), July 2, 2015

Loving Others as the Good Shepherd has Loved Us, Fourth Sunday of Easter (B), April 26, 2015

Entering into the Triple Expression of Jesus’ and Christian Consecration, Holy Thursday, April 2, 2015

Almsgiving, The Anchor, March 6, 2015

Day of Recollection for Men, St. Francis Xavier Parish in Acushnet, MA, February 28, 2015

Going Daily to the Source and Summit of Christian Life, The Anchor, February 13, 2015

The General Examination, The Anchor, January 30, 2015

The Morning Offering, The Anchor, January 23, 2015

Basing Our Christian and Priestly Life on the Foundation of the Apostles, SS. Simon and Jude, October 28, 2014

The Apostles’ Crash Course in Christian Trust, 18th Monday (II), August 4, 2014

Hungering For, Recognizing and Sacrificing to Obtain the Treasure of the Kingdom, Seventeenth Sunday (A), July 27, 2014

The Priesthood as the Continued Incarnation of Jesus’ Love, Fifth Thursday of Easter, May 22, 2014

Coming Out of Our Tombs, Fifth Sunday of Lent (A), April 6, 2014

(2009) What Priests Today Can Learn From the Patron Saint of Parish Priests, April 13-15, 2009

Pope Francis and Priestly Charity, January 22, 2014

Pope Francis and the Art of Christian and Priestly Prayer, January 21-22, 2014

High Gates, Efficacious Names and God’s Excessive Generosity, Fourth Sunday of Advent (A), December 22, 2013

Mother of Mercy: The Blessed Virgin Mary and the Sacrament of Penance, December 6, 2013

The Collision of Two Processions, Catholic Online Year of Faith Homily Series, September 17, 2013

Following St. Bernadette to Eternal Happiness, September 16, 2013

Prayer: Faith in Action, Retreat for the Sisters of Jesus our Hope (Two Parts), July 29 to August 2, 2013

The Wounding of Christ’s Heart, The Anchor, June 7, 2013

Investing the Talent of the Mass, Thirty-third Sunday in Ordinary Time (A), November 13, 2011 Audio Homily

St. Vianney on Confession, November 2011

Working for the Eucharist, Eighteenth Sunday in Ordinary Time (B), August 2, 2009 (Audio included)

The Curé of Ars and the Ars Confessoris, Seminar for Priests, April 13-15, 2009